Rahul targets PM on Rafale, dares him for a debate

Last Updated 06 September 2019, 10:41 IST

Targetting prime minister Narendra Modi on the Rafale deal, Congress president Rahul Gandhi on Friday dared him for a public debate on corruption."I am asking for a debate on corruption, let him come and debate with me," Gandhi said addressing a rally at the MMRDA grounds at the Bandra Kurla Complex in Mumbai here.

Referring to Modi as "chowkidar" in his speech several times, he said that - "chowkidar chor hi nahi, darpok bhi hai" - and pointed out that in the Parliament, the prime minister has refused to answer the pointed questions of Congress on the Rafale deal.

During the day, Gandhi addressed two rallies - in Dhule in Khandesh-North Maharashtra and Mumbai, during which he spoke on the Rafale issue."Did Anil Ambani make Mirage and Sukhois?, " Gandhi said in the backdrop of the Pulwama terror attacks and India's strike in terror camps in Pakistan and Pakistan-occupied-Kashmir.

He wanted to know why the manufacturing contract was given to Anil Ambani's company and not Hindustan Aeronautics Ltd. "For years they have been making planes, Anil Ambani cannot even make paper planes," Gandhi said.

Earlier, he paid tributes to the CRPF personnel who died in the Pulwama terror attack and the IAF pilots and airmen who died in Budgam helicopter crash.

Gandhi also said that the demonetisation was a failed exercise. "You stood in a queue outside banks... did Anil Ambani, Nirav Modi, Mehul Choksi, Lalit Modi, Vijay Mallya stood in queue...while you stood in queue outside banks, they made their black money white," he said.

"Modiji said (before 2014 elections)...do not make me prime minister, make me 'chowkidar'....and once he becomes PM, he puts Rs 30,000 crore in pockets of Anil Ambani," he accused.
